The Core Curriculum for children between the ages of 3 and 5 includes 45 lessons that work to develop the motivation and skills for children to be economically self-supporting as they grow older, but more important, that the children understand their own unique intelligences and value them as God’s gifts. The lesson content is geared toward cultivating unique interests and intelligences in order to build a greater sense of self. The units focus on “Who Am I?,” “Colors and Shapes,” “Understanding My Community,” “Where Does My Food Come From?,” “Understanding the World Around Me,” and “I Can Tell Stories” as lesson unit content. Each lesson includes guided instructions for the teacher, including preparation, a script, and suggested activities to facilitate further learning in a fun and interactive manner.
